Fayetteville Woman Dies in Prairie County Accident
By: KNWA News
Updated: December 12, 2012
A Fayetteville woman was killed in an accident Tuesday afternoon on I-40 in Prairie County.
According to a State Police crash report, 33-year-old Kristin G. Jackson was killed when the Ford Escort she was riding in was pinned between two tractor- trailers.
The crash report says all four vehicles involved were Westbound when the Ford Escort, driven by Justin Jackson, stopped behind one tractor- trailer that had stopped for construction.
A second semi-truck, driven by Micharl Serrat of Ft. Smith, was unable to stop and rear-ended the Escort, forcing it into the trailer of the semi-truck in front.
A third semi-truck, driven by Valerie Powers of Jonesboro, GA was also unable to stop and rear-ended the truck driven by Serrat.
Justin Jackson, also from Fayetteville, was injured and taken to UAMS in Little Rock.
According to the report, everyone involved wore a seat belt. There were no other injuries.
